bq51050B / NTC Circuit Options

Hi Everyone,

My customer is designing resistors connected to TS/CTRL pin. Then I received following question. Please confirm it and give your comment.

  1. Which situation do you recommend to add R3? They hope to use right circuit simply.
  2. Can we remove R1 and use only NTC? Please let me know if you have recommended NTC which can use without R1. (For example 103AT from Semitec)

Best Regards,

Sonoki / Japan Disty

  • Satoshi-san,

    The R1 and R3 values are all based on the customer desired hot and cold temperature. So customer can use the formula in the datasheet to calculate those two values. For example, if R3 is 100 times bigger than R1+RNTC, then you can probably remove R3 as its impact is minimum. Similarly, if R1 is much much smaller than RNTC, then R1 can probably be removed too.

    Again, it's all depending on the hot and cold temperature that customer wants to set.
